French Doors and Windows: An Elegant Addition to Any Home
French doors and windows have actually long been commemorated for their visual appeal and versatile performance. With expansive glass panels that allow natural light and offer unblocked views, these architectural functions serve a dual function: boosting the charm of a home while promoting an inviting atmosphere. This short article checks out the various characteristics of French doors and windows, their historic significance, benefits and drawbacks, style options, setup considerations, and maintenance suggestions.
The Charm of French Doors and Windows
Historic Background
Coming from the 17th century during the Renaissance duration, French doors were developed to emphasize light and natural vistas. Generally used as access to balconies, gardens, and patios, they have actually because developed to become popular architectural components throughout the globe. French windows share a comparable history, often serving the same function of connecting indoor areas with the exterior.
Attributes of French Doors
French doors are known for their unique design features:
- Double Panels: Typically made up of 2 hinged doors that swing open, using an unobstructed opening.
- Glass Construction: Glass panes dominate the surface areas, frequently framed by wood or metal, offering adequate light and heat.
- Versatile Operation: They can either swing open up to the interior or exterior, depending upon the design.
- Variety of Styles: French doors come in several designs, consisting of conventional, modern, and French home designs.
Characteristics of French Windows
Likewise, French windows exhibit unique qualities:
- Vertical Orientation: Like doors, they typically include two or more panes but are created to open vertically, boosting room airflow.
- Grille Patterns: The grids frequently complement other architectural elements, producing a cohesive try to find homes.
- Integration with Outdoor Spaces: They typically lead onto balconies, patios, or gardens, promoting a smooth combination of indoor and outdoor living.
Advantages of French Doors and Windows
Incorporating French doors and windows into a property comes with numerous advantages:
- Natural Light Exposure: Their expansive glass surfaces enable more daytime, creating an enjoyable and buoyant energy in the home.
- Enhanced Aesthetics: French doors and windows contribute to an advanced appearance, raising the general visual appeal of area.
- Outdoor Connectivity: They flawlessly link the interior of a home with its outside space, promoting a more open and airy feel.
- Increased Property Value: Elegant architectural features can enhance the marketplace value of a home.
- Flexibility: They can be utilized in different settings, consisting of dining locations, living spaces, and even as entry indicate gardens.
Disadvantages of French Doors and Windows
While there are numerous benefits, it is vital to think about the possible disadvantages:
- Space Requirements: Swinging doors need adequate space, which might not appropriate for smaller sized homes.
- Upkeep: The substantial glass surface areas necessitate regular cleansing and upkeep to avoid grime and enhance visibility.
- Energy Efficiency: Depending on the material and building quality, they might not always offer optimum insulation, potentially leading to increased energy expenses.
- Security Concerns: Glass windows and doors can be more vulnerable to break-ins if not reinforced with appropriate security functions.
Style Options for French Doors and Windows
When choosing French windows and doors, house owners have a variety of design options offered:
- Material Choices: Common products include wood, fiberglass, aluminum, and vinyl, each offering different visual and functional characteristics.
- Glass Types: Options range from clear to frosted, tempered, or double-glazed, differing based on personal privacy needs and energy performance standards.
- Grille Patterns: Grilles can add an ornamental touch; house owners can choose from numerous styles, such as colonial, grassy field, or modern.
- Colors and Finishes: Custom paint colors and finishes can complement existing decoration, whether a strong declaration or a subtle color.
Type | Advantages | Drawbacks |
---|---|---|
Wood | Visually pleasing, flexible | Needs upkeep, may warp |
Fiberglass | Outstanding insulation, low maintenance | More expensive than wood |
Aluminum | Durable, weather-resistant | Poor insulation, can feel cold |
Vinyl | Low maintenance, energy-efficient | Limited color options |
Setup Considerations
When going with French doors and windows, it is important to consider the following installation factors:
- Professional Help: Hiring proficient experts can make sure appropriate setup and decrease issues associated with leaks and drafts.
- Structural Changes: Installing French doors might need structural modifications, particularly for walls that do not initially accommodate such openings.
- Building regulations: Homeowners need to examine local building guidelines and get necessary authorizations before making restorations.
- Product Selection: Choosing the right materials will substantially impact the longevity and performance of the installation.
Upkeep Tips for French Doors and Windows
To maximize the life expectancy and efficiency of French doors and windows, homeowners need to adopt correct upkeep practices:
- Regular Cleaning: Wipe down glass surfaces routinely to eliminate dirt, finger prints, and streaks using a glass cleaner or vinegar solution.
- Examine Seals and Caulking: Regularly look for worn seals and caulking around frames to keep energy efficiency.
- Oil Hinges: Apply lube to hinges and handles to guarantee smooth operation of swinging doors and opening windows.
-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Steer clear of abrasive materials that may scratch or harm the glass or frames.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is the difference between French doors and outdoor patio doors?
French doors normally include glass panels with a more standard style, using a sophisticated look, while patio area doors typically describe sliding glass doors that operate horizontally.
2. Are French doors energy-efficient?
French doors can be energy-efficient if they are made from premium materials with correct insulation. Double-glazed options offer better temperature level guideline.
3. Can I install French doors myself?
Although DIY installation is possible, it is frequently recommended to employ specialists due to the complexities involved, including structural adjustments and guaranteeing proper sealing.
4. Do French doors improve home value?
Yes, French windows and doors can enhance the aesthetics and functionality of a home, potentially increasing its market worth.
5. What are the best products for French doors?
The finest materials depend upon private preferences and goals. Wood is visually pleasing, fiberglass offers exceptional insulation, aluminum is long lasting and low-maintenance, while vinyl is energy-efficient.
